As a key member of the interdisciplinary clinic team, the Clinical Care Coordinator (CCC) plays an essential role in supporting members' daily experiences and sense of belonging at Amae Health.
You'll help create a warm, engaging environment by facilitating group activities, wellness programming that encourage connection and growth. Working closely with our clinicians and staff, you'll share insights and contribute to a collaborative approach to member care. In addition to member engagement, you'll support clinic operations by managing communications, maintaining accurate records, and assisting with daily workflows.

- Member Engagement & Support - Facilitate groups, arts and crafts, and recreational activities to enhance the member experience at Amae Health. Encourage positive social interactions and engagement in daily programming.
- Clinic & Operational Support - Welcome members to the clinic, manage communications via phone and email, and assist with scheduling and member record updates to support smooth daily operations.
- Team Collaboration - Collaborate with the interdisciplinary care team-including psychiatrists, therapists, dietitians, and primary care providers-to share observations and support coordinated member care. Participate in team meetings and contribute to discussions about member engagement.
- Member Advocacy & Resource Connection - Identify members' ongoing needs and help connect them with community resources and supports that promote wellness.
- Growth & Development - Contribute to projects that support clinic growth and ongoing member success. Participate in training and supervision to build skills in mental health support, community resources, and member engagement.

- Enrolled or recently graduated in a degree program related to mental health, such as pre-med, psychology, social work, or nursing
- Interest in mental health and desire to work with members with Severe Mental Illness
- Strong interpersonal skills and ability to work in a team environment
- Comfortable working either one-on-one or in group settings, must possess excellent interpersonal skills and be able to adapt to changing situations
- Well-organized and some experience planning and designing events and activities
- The candidate should possess a holistic perspective of "health." Clinical Care Coordinators will demonstrate the ability to work effectively in a wide range of settings with people from diverse backgrounds, including members and co-workers
